Tomcat日志中的内存泄漏如何发现-小浪学习网

Tomcat日志中的内存泄漏如何发现

要识别Tomcat日志中是否存在内存泄漏,可以参考以下方法: 开启垃圾回收日志记录:在启动Tomcat时,通过添加如下JVM参数来记录垃圾回收的相关信息: -XX:PrintGCDetails -XX:PrintGCDateStamps ...
站长的头像-小浪学习网月度会员站长8天前
475
【Linux课程学习】:《简易版shell实现和原理》 《哪些命令可以让子进程执行,哪些命令让shell执行(内键命令)?为什么?》-小浪学习网

【Linux课程学习】:《简易版shell实现和原理》 《哪些命令可以让子进程执行,哪些命令让shell执行(内键命令)?为什么?》

1.我们让子进程执行cd ..命令的时候,为什么我们执行pwd命令的时候,还是和之前一样,路径没有变化? 本质就是,我们更改的是子进程的环境变量pwd,没有改变父进程的。当执行pwd时,这个进程的...
站长的头像-小浪学习网月度会员站长6天前
407
Golang的defer机制使用技巧与性能影响-小浪学习网

Golang的defer机制使用技巧与性能影响

defer 是 go 语言中用于延迟执行的机制,其核心作用是在函数返回前执行清理操作。常见使用场景包括资源释放(如关闭文件、数据库连接)、配合 recover 捕获 panic 防止程序崩溃。defer 的性能影...
站长的头像-小浪学习网月度会员站长3天前
407
PHP错误处理:常见问题与解决方案-小浪学习网

PHP错误处理:常见问题与解决方案

php错误处理需根据场景选择合适方法。首先,配置错误报告级别,开发时用error_reporting(e_all),生产环境关闭不必要提示;其次,使用@抑制符谨慎处理已知可能失败的操作;第三,通过set_error_...
站长的头像-小浪学习网月度会员站长前天
335
c语言中的排序算法有哪些 qsort函数如何使用-小浪学习网

c语言中的排序算法有哪些 qsort函数如何使用

c语言中qsort函数的使用方法和注意事项如下:1.qsort基于快速排序实现,平均时间复杂度为o(n log n),最坏为o(n²),且通常不稳定;2.其函数原型为void qsort(void base, size_t nmemb, size_t ...
站长的头像-小浪学习网月度会员站长前天
4412
mysql如何实现数据同步?同步优化方法-小浪学习网

mysql如何实现数据同步?同步优化方法

mysql实现数据同步的核心方式是主从复制,通过二进制日志在多个实例间保持一致性,适用于读写分离、备份、负载均衡等场景。1. 基本配置包括开启主库二进制日志、创建复制账号并授权、配置从库se...
站长的头像-小浪学习网月度会员站长57分钟前
505
apache服务器缓存模块有哪些-小浪学习网

apache服务器缓存模块有哪些

apache服务器缓存 apache服务器缓存工作原理           ( 推荐学习:Apache服务器 ) 上面是一个简单的流程图: 用户1访问A页面,服务器解析A页面返回给用户1,同时在服务器内存上做一定映...
站长的头像-小浪学习网月度会员站长2年前
478
linux中etc是什么-小浪学习网

linux中etc是什么

在linux中,etc是一个目录,用于存放系统主要的配置文件,来源于法语“et cetera”;该目录下的文件属性可以让一般用户进行查阅,但是只有root用户有权利进行修改。 本教程操作环境:linux7.3系...
站长的头像-小浪学习网月度会员站长1年前
3112
UAVStack中JVM监控分析工具怎么用-小浪学习网

UAVStack中JVM监控分析工具怎么用

引言 作为allinone的智能化服务技术栈,uavstack提供了非常全面的监控数据采样功能,同时支持数据监控与预警。近期,我们整合了原有的数据采集展示功能,新增jvm分析功能,推出了更易用的jvm监...
站长的头像-小浪学习网月度会员站长10个月前
357
浅析 Linux 中的零拷贝技术-小浪学习网

浅析 Linux 中的零拷贝技术

本文探讨Linux中 主要的几种零拷贝技术 以及零拷贝技术 适用的场景 。为了迅速建立起零拷贝的概念,我们拿一个常用的场景进行引入: 引文 在写一个服务端程序时(Web Server或者文件服务器),...
站长的头像-小浪学习网月度会员站长6个月前
227